Crawl Space Water Damage Repair Cost In Reese, UT

The cost of Crawl Space Water Damage Repair in Reese, UT can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Contamination and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Final Inspection and Repair $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Equipment Rental $100 – $500 Duration of rental, equipment needed, and local conditions
Debris Removal $500 – $2,000 Size of debris, equipment needed, and local conditions
